Transaction d99845e7c3c61b01635c3483f51a394c9b240598907c02d0c1bc815be668c399

9 Input
1 Outputs
  • d99845e7c3c61b01635c3483f51a394c9b240598907c02d0c1bc815be668c399:0
  • value  5044263
    address  33UHYd4Aa4PxTFVK6qVJhXt5XaFB2G2mPs